    Subject[PATCH 0/4] bam dma fixes and one dt extension
    Date
    Here are three bam dma fixes, which I made during testing qcrypto
    driver. The first one is a real fix, the second one is related to
    peripherals on which the BAM IP is initialized by remote execution
    environment, and the third one is a sleeping bug IMO.

    The last patch is a extension again for peripherals which BAM is
    remotely controlled by other execution environment.

    All patches has been tested on db410c board with apq8016.
